What is the Least Common Multiple of 83812 and 83823?
Least common multiple or lowest common denominator (lcd) can be calculated in two way; with the LCM formula calculation of greatest common factor (GCF), or multiplying the prime factors with the highest exponent factor.
Least common multiple (LCM) of 83812 and 83823 is 7025373276.
LCM(83812,83823) = 7025373276
Least Common Multiple of 83812 and 83823 with GCF Formula
The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 83812 and 83823, than apply into the LCM equation.
GCF(83812,83823) = 1
LCM(83812,83823) = ( 83812 × 83823) / 1
LCM(83812,83823) = 7025373276 / 1
LCM(83812,83823) = 7025373276
